Key Ceremony Checklist — Item 7: Tracing keys. Before we sign the new signing key for Ombrell's trace-propagation headers, confirm every microservice forwards the trace ID unchanged (gateway, cart, ledger — all of them). New folks: this is how we stitch a request across twelve hops, so don't skip it. Once verified, unseal the ceremony vault by entering the recovery passphrase below.

recovery phrase for fajep-yaweg: gilath-sorox-wenius-rusdor-keliel-zorius

### Runbook: BounceBroom — Account Recovery

If the BounceBroom email bounce processor loses access to its service account, do not create a new one. First, pause the intake queue so bounces buffer safely. Then open the recovery console and select the BounceBroom principal. Verification requires approval from the on-call lead. Once approved, the console prompts for the stored recovery credentials; enter the passphrase that appears directly below this paragraph.

recovery phrase for fahof-kahap: holion-gormir-jorix-istix-briwyn-sorael

- [ ] **Step 7: Breaker override escrow.** After sealing the signing keys for the Tallgrove upstream API circuit breaker, confirm the support team can force the breaker open during a full outage. The override bundle lives in the sealed escrow drawer and is useless without its unlock phrase. Two ceremony witnesses must initial this step before proceeding. The escrow bundle is decrypted with the recovery passphrase that follows.

vault phrase of kahip-kahop = holath-quenmir